General physical/thermodynamic constants:

Absolute zero temperature = -273.2 K

Faraday's constant: F = 9.649 x 104 C/mole

Plank's constant: h = 6.626 x 10-34 Js

The speed of light: c = 2.998 x 108 m/s

 

Constants For Water

CS (specific heat capacity of ice) = 1.95 J/( K g)

Boiling point = 100 C

Freezing point = 0 C

Molecular weight = 18
